More than 1,000 planned operations and over 3,000 outpatient appointments have been postponed amid disruption caused by a cyber attack that impacted London hospitals.
Synnovis, an agency which manages labs for NHS trusts and GPs in south-east London, was the victim of a data hack on 3rd June 2024.
New figures, external from NHS England show that since then, 3,396 appointments and 1,255 elective procedures have been postponed.
In a statement, the chief executives of two affected trusts said they were continuing to manage the attack as a "critical incident".
